4. Do you have a nickname, if so what is it and how did you get it? Shrimper, It started from some fellow racers, when they found out that I lived in Aransas Pass. Aransas Pass is known as a shrimping community. So they called my car a shrimp boat, and always asked me if I had any shrimp for sale. So I just had fun with it and started wearing white shrimp boots around the pits before the races.
